| About the Book
Sunday homilies can be a meaningful part of the Christian
experience. Homilies for the Year - B provides 52 weeks
of insight, based on an understanding of Sunday readings from an
exegetical point of view, and gives practical applications for
today's world. Ample quotations from the Scriptures, proverbs,
citations and short stories beef up the homilies, and Suggestions
for Introduction to the Mass and the Prayers of the Faithful
complete the section for each Sunday.
As Cardinal Gantin has written in the Preface,
the author brings to this book his vast experience spanning French,
Indian and African cultures. And an eye for good passages:
"Were not our hearts burning within us while he
was talking to us on the road, and opening the Scriptures to us", said
the disciples of Emmaus (Luke 24:32).
To this experience the homilies call us. You are
invited to taste and feel the Word of God and then find its meaning in
your life.
A valuable helping hand for priests and
catechists preparing their Sunday homilies, and ordinary people who,
in the parishes, come together for Bible studies.
